Changes: three roles (viewer, contributor, steward); page-level overrides removed; admin actions now audit-logged; anonymous editing disabled tenant-wide. Risk: steward role can export full page history. Mitigation: export gated behind two-person approval. Testing: permission matrix verified across 42 cases, all passing. No open findings. Deployment blocked pending security review. Please confirm the role matrix matches policy before Thursday's freeze. Sign-off goes below, under the name of the responsible owner.

account owner for kafop-badug: Briwyn Drueth

**Onboarding: Quotefall circuit breaker**

New folks: the Quotefall pricing API flaps weekly. Our breaker in `gatekeep-svc` trips after 5 consecutive 5xx responses, holds open for 90s, then half-opens with one probe call. Don't bypass it; the upstream throttles hard and we've been rate-banned twice. Dashboards live under the Gatekeep board in Lanternview. If the breaker gets stuck open after a deploy, reset it from the admin console using the passphrase below.

unlock words, hahip-baduf: holwyn-istath-julvan

## Authentication

Bouncewright, our email bounce processor, requires authenticated access to the Mailgate internal service before it can classify or suppress addresses. Support staff should note that every request is signed; an invalid or expired credential causes bounces to queue silently rather than fail loudly, so always verify auth first when investigating backlogs. Credentials are environment-specific and rotate on the first of each month. The current production key is listed immediately below.

gateway credential: kto3_qfe

## LiftSim 2.4.0 — key rotation

Welcome aboard. This release rotates the artifact signing key for the elevator-dispatch simulator. Background: the prior key predated the Hallowell infra migration and was flagged stale by our internal scanner. All simulator builds, scenario packs, and the dispatch-policy plugins are now signed with the replacement. Old signatures stop validating at end of sprint. Update your local verification config before pulling new builds. For reference during onboarding, the current signing key is below.

rollout seal: bky9_PeXH1fTLY